Log:

PR target/26600
* config/i386/i386.c (legitimate_constant_p) CONST_DOUBLE: TImode
integer constants other than zero are only legitimate on TARGET_64BIT.
CONST_VECTOR Only zero vectors are legitimate.
(ix86_cannot_force_const_mem): Integral and vector constants can
always be put in the constant pool.

* gcc.target/i386/pr26600.c: New test case.

[Bug target/26600] [4.1/4.2 Regression] internal compiler error: in push_reload, at reload.c:1303

2006-03-08 Thread rguenth at gcc dot gnu dot org


--- Comment #2 from rguenth at gcc dot gnu dot org  2006-03-08 10:18 ---
For mainline, this is a dup of 26449.  For 4.1.0 I can reproduce this:

#1  0x08493eae in push_reload (in=0x4023a4b8, out=0x40241280, 
inloc=0x40244a84, outloc=0x40229be0, class=NO_REGS, inmode=V4SImode, 
outmode=TImode, strict_low=0, optional=0, opnum=0, type=RELOAD_OTHER)
at /space/rguenther/src/svn/gcc-4_1-branch/gcc/reload.c:1302

  gcc_assert (class != NO_REGS
  || (optional != 0  type == RELOAD_FOR_OUTPUT));

(gdb) call debug_rtx (in)
(const_vector:V4SI [
(const_int 9633 [0x25a1])
(const_int 9633 [0x25a1])
(const_int 9633 [0x25a1])
(const_int 9633 [0x25a1])
])
(gdb) call debug_rtx (out)
(reg:TI 23 xmm2)

this problem may be latent on the mainline (so I make it depend on 26449).
This is a regression in that we didn't ICE here for 4.0, but we didn't do any
vectorization there either.

So, who's the reload expert for vector stuff ;)
